Join the Frost School of Music as a Temporary Assistant Director of Admission and immerse yourself in the vibrant world of music education.

In this fast-paced role, you'll team up with our Director to manage the day-to-day operations of processing applications for our esteemed graduate and undergraduate programs. From coordinating international admissions to assisting with recruitment events, you'll be at the heart of our admission process.

We're looking for someone with a keen eye for detail and a passion for music to assist with various tasks, including updating our admissions website and compiling data to support our admission efforts. With opportunities for travel to events like college fairs and auditions, every day brings new excitement and challenges.

Responsibilities:

  • Manages, in conjunction with the Director, the day-to-day activities related to processing graduate and undergraduate applications
  • Participate in and coordinate international admission efforts
  • Assist in coordinating the undergraduate/graduate admission process
  • Assist with recruitment and yield programs and activities
  • Assist with annual and one-off updates to the admissions website and recruitment materials
  • Help manage and compile annual changes and updates to admissions system (CaneLink, Slideroom, Slate) including such things as Graduate Checklist, Slideroom/Slate reports and queue management flow.
  • Compile and analyze new data and make recommendations as needed to assist in admission efforts
  • Stay informed of recruitment goals and strategies
  • Travel as needed to high schools/college fairs/regional auditions/conventions/summer camps
  • Reconcile problem files
  • Maintain electronic and paper records from initial contact to matriculation
  • Notify applicants of confirmed audition dates/times/locations
  • Merge and mail all prescreen/audition results
  • Assist in preparation of audition day materials/schedules for applicants
  • Manages, in conjunction with the Director, the prescreening/online audition process
  • Contributes information and ideas related to the general admissions/auditions/recruitment process
  • Coordinates the activities of work-study students
  • Reply to correspondences, phone calls and emails from prospective applicants and their parents, and faculty
  • Counsel prospective students, applicants and their families through the application/audition process
  • Interact with faculty as needed; providing relevant information about applicants, processes, and requirements

  • Assist the Director of Admissions Recruitment as needed
  • Schedule visits for individuals/groups and give tours as needed
  • Attend admission meetings in the Director’s absence
  • Reports to the Director of Admissions on a daily basis
  • Other responsibilities as needed

Position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ree (music preferred, but not required)
  • Strong computer competency required including proficiency in Word and Excel; CaneLink experience is a plus
  • Comfort with the Internet and web based communication
  • Willingness to learn new software and to develop new skills as required
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ills
  • Strong interpersonal skills and professionalism and exceptional dedication to customer service
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ment
  • Great organizational and time management skills with attention to detail
